Lenovo has introduced the AI Workmate Concept at MWC 2026, a desktop robot powered by an Intel Core Ultra processor, with 64GB of memory and a built-in Pico projector. This proof-of-concept device is designed to assist with office tasks through voice commands, large language models, and on-device AI processing. Although it is still a prototype without confirmed pricing or availability, its unique features position it as a potential tool for enhancing workplace productivity.

In terms of market context, the AI Workmate’s functionality sets it apart from other digital assistants and office tools, such as smart speakers or productivity-focused devices. While products such as the Amazon Echo Show or Google Nest Hub range from $100 to $250, offering basic voice assistance and smart home integration, the AI Workmate aims to provide advanced document scanning and presentation capabilities. A more straightforward alternative could be Lenovo’s AI Work Companion Concept, which is a simpler desk clock with basic scheduling features and is likely to be more budget-friendly.
